Climate overview of Shcherbinka
Shcherbinka, Moscow region, Russia, sees big temperature differences between seasons, with July peaking at 25°C (77°F) and February dropping to -3°C (27°F).
The city receives around 711 mm (28 in) of rain/snowfall per year. July is the wettest month and March the driest. The sunniest month is June, with 9.2 hours of sunshine per day on average.

Monthly Temperature in Shcherbinka
Visitors to Shcherbinka can expect significant temperature changes throughout the year. On average, daytime temperatures range from a comfortable 25°C (77°F) in July to a very cold -3°C (27°F) in February.
Nighttime temperatures range from 15°C (59°F) in July to -10°C (14°F) in February.

Rainfall in Shcherbinka
Generally, Shcherbinka experiences moderate precipitation patterns, averaging 711 mm (28 in) yearly. The amount of precipitation varies moderately throughout the year. The wettest month, July, sees around 86 mm (3.4 in) of rainfall, perfect for those who enjoy a bit of rain now and then. Sunshine Hours in Shcherbinka
In Shcherbinka, summer days are longer and more sunny, with daily sunshine hours peaking at 9.2 hours in June. As the darker season arrives, the brightness of the sun becomes less. December sees a soft sun for only 0.6 hours per average day.

Humidity in Shcherbinka by Month
The relative humidity is high throughout the year in Shcherbinka.

Frequently asked questions about the climate in Shcherbinka
What is the best time to visit Shcherbinka?
May, June, July and August typically offer the most optimal weather in Shcherbinka. In contrast, January, February, March, October, November and December tend to have less optimal conditions.
What temperatures can I expect in Shcherbinka?
Daytime highs range from -3°C (27°F) in February to 25°C (77°F) in July. Nighttime lows range from -10°C (14°F) to 15°C (59°F). Temperatures vary considerably through the year.
How much rain does Shcherbinka get?
Annual rainfall is around 711 mm (28 in). July is the wettest month with 86 mm (3.4 in), while March is the driest with 40 mm (1.6 in).
How sunny is Shcherbinka?
Shcherbinka receives around 1,721 hours of sunshine per year. June is the sunniest month with 276 hours, while December is the cloudiest with just 19 hours.
